Delphi的调试

Delphi的调试

集成式调试器是Delphi IDE的一个重要特性。该调试器使用户能方便地设置断点、监视变量、检查对象等等。在运行程序时,使用该调试器能快速查找出程序发生了什么(或未发生什么)。一个号的调试器对程序开发的效率至关重要。

调试工作容易被忽略。我也是刚开始学习Windows编程时,很长时间都未理睬调试器,因为当时忙于学习如何编写Windows应用程序。当后来知道这是一个很有价值的调试器的后,才后悔为什么没有早点使用它。希望大家从我的经历中吸取教训。

微信截图_20190722174517.png

一、为什么使用调试器

对于这个问题的回答很简单:调试器能帮助用户查找程序中的错误。

但是,调试过程不仅仅是查找错误,它还是一个开发工具。尽管调试很重要,但仍有很多程序员不愿花时间来学习如何使用IDE调试器的各种性能。结果,他们付出了更多的时间和精力,更不用提由于查不出程序中的错误而导致的失败。

可在调试器下启动程序,开始调试,也可按【F9】自动地使用调试器。

二、调试器菜单项

在详细介绍调试器之前,先来看看有关调试器的菜单项目。其中一些菜单项在主菜单的【Run】下,另一些在Code Editor的快捷菜单上。

1、Code Editor快捷菜单中的调试菜单项

.1.png

①【Toggle Breakpoint】快捷键【F5】在Code Editor中的当前行上设置或关闭一个断点

②【Run to Cursor】快捷键【F4】启动程序并运行该程序至Code Editor中光标所在行

③【Goto Address…】快捷键【Ctrl + Alt + G】允许用户指定程序中的一个地址,程序在此地址恢复执行

④【Inspect…】快捷键【Alt + F5】为光标所在对象打开Debug Inspect窗口

⑤【Evaluate/Modify…】快捷键【Ctrl + F7】允许用户在运行时查看、修改变量

⑥【Add Watch at Cursor】快捷键【Ctrl + F5】将光标所指变量添加到Watch List中

⑦【View CPU】快捷键【Ctrl + Alt + C】显示CPU窗口

主菜单上【Run】菜单项是一个下拉菜单,有若干菜单项与调试器下运行程序有关。Run菜单项使用户能在调试器下启动一个程序、终止运行在调试器下的程序、命名若干个函数。其中有些菜单项与Code Editor中的菜单项目一样。

发表评论:

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

搜索
«   2019年8月   »
1234
567891011
12131415161718
19202122232425
262728293031
网站分类
控制面板
您好,欢迎到访网站!
  查看权限
最近发表
友情链接
文章详情
首页 > Delphi的调试
时间:2019年07月22日 17:46:15
分类:Delphi程序调试
阅读:54次
上文:Delphi绘制文本的DrawText函数
下文:Delphi的调试器的菜单项目

返回顶部